    Study Notes

    Spelling Bee Words Overview

    • Total of 100 spelling words for 3rd-grade students to master.
    • Each word contributes to vocabulary development and spelling skills.

    Key Vocabulary List

    • less: Indicates a smaller amount or degree.
    • seems: Suggests appearance or impression.
    • shot: A quick action or movement, often referring to a throw or a photograph.
    • outside: Refers to the external part of a space.
    • list: A series of items or names written sequentially.
    • ready: Prepared for action or use.
    • cave: A natural underground space, typically large and deep.
    • used: Indicating something that has been utilized.
    • hogs: A term for domestic pigs, often refers to overindulgence.
    • color: A characteristic of visual perception described through categories like red, blue, etc.
